Choosing a Large Clay Chiminea
Mexican Chimeneas are among the best functioning fire pits for patios. They are easy to assemble and light. They are not designed for fireplaces that roar. Size
A large chiminea of clay can be a stunning addition to your outdoor entertainment space. It will add warmth and charm as well as add an element of Mexican tradition to your patio or garden. You can also make use of an chiminea to cook food on a grill, or adding a fire pit to your garden to let children to play. Think about the material, size and style of your chiminea, and any safety features and other features.
Take into consideration the space available in your backyard prior to you begin looking for the ideal chiminea. You should ensure that you have enough space for the chiminea as well as a safe distance from flammable materials, such as structures or overhangs. Also, remember that a large chiminea made of clay might require more care than smaller ones.
There are a variety of chimineas and you should pick the one that best suits your style and lifestyle. You can even purchase a large clay chiminea that comes with a chimney and cover to shield it from the elements. Covers are essential to stop wind from blowing out the flames.
Another aspect to consider when purchasing a chiminea is the cost. The most expensive models are usually made from hand-thrown clay and feature more authentic designs. They are also more durable than the cheaper Chimineas and require less care.
Chimineas made from clay need to be "cured" (which means they must go through several small fires) before they can be used. This curing process may take some time however it will allow you to enjoy your chiminea for a long time to be. It is crucial to keep in mind that your chiminea will still be fragile, especially if it's exposed to the elements.
Once you have a chiminea of clay, be sure to keep it in a dry place for the winter. This will shield the chiminea from moisture and freezing conditions that can harm it. Alternately, you can put it in a garage or shed to reduce its exposure to the elements. When you're ready to use it it's time to clean it up to make it look as nice as new.

Chimineas are usually made from clay from terracotta, but they can also be constructed out of steel or cast iron. Some are glaze that gives a classic Mexican design to your backyard. Terra cotta is the most common material however there are other options to choose from as well.
Both cast iron and clay Chimineas need to be dried prior to use, which involves making small fires and gradually increasing the amount of heat. If you don't correctly cure them, they can break and cause other damage because of sudden temperature fluctuations. Certain of the more recent clay chimineas are made from grogged clay, which helps them resist this damage and cracking.

Clay chimineas can withstand high temperatures and are durable but they require regular maintenance in order to avoid damage. They should be heated in cold temperatures prior to use, then sealed twice per year and cleaned on a regular basis. When not in use, they should be covered with a waterproof chiminea.
As with any outdoor fire feature, a chiminea is dangerous and should be placed on a level surface that is free of low-hanging branches, dry grass and other flammable materials. It is also important to ensure that there is a water source nearby in the event of an emergency.
A large chiminea made of clay when maintained properly will last for longer than any other type of outdoor fire feature. The clay insulates against heat and helps the fire burn slower and cooler, which decreases the risk of smoke inhalation. They are also less susceptible to cracking than cast-iron chimneys, however, they might require curing prior to use, and are generally heavier.
A large clay chiminea or a chiminea made of metal can be used to cook food, however it has less cooking options than a grill or barbecue. It is possible to cook fish, meat and other vegetables with a chiminea but it is recommended not to cook food directly in open flames as this could cause the chiminea to break or crack.

Before you can use a brand new clay chiminea, it's important that you "cure" it. Fill the chiminea as much as three inches with river sand, and then burn a few smaller pieces. Once the kindling is burned out you can add larger pieces of wood and gradually increase the size of the fire until it's hot enough to burn sand. This will prevent the chiminea's lining from cracking when exposed to extreme temperatures.
